I've driven the ring in a bmw 328i
Although the 993 driver is good I agree with whiteout that the 997 driver wasn't pushing as hard because he has a car worth over 180,000 euros.

I was blowing past lambos because they simply weren't pushing as hard - not because I was such a better driver - the ring isn't a race track where people race each other for the most part - most people come to just test themselves and their cars.(unless it's a sanctioned race event- in which case these guys wouldn't be on track)

And there are lots of accidents that can spook people
